Prime Minister Narendra Modi addressed the joint session of the US Congress on Thursday, June 22. There were 12 standing ovations by members of congress, and 2 separate standing ovations by the Indian community members in the gallery, as PM Modi addressed the US Congress for nearly an hour.

Talking about Americans with Indian roots, he pointed at US Vice President Kamala Harris. "There are many Americans with Indian roots sitting in our midst. There is one behind me, who has made history," said PM Modi, as he pointed at Harris.
